General Plant Information (Edit)
Plant Habit: Herb/Forb
Life cycle: Annual
Sun Requirements: Full Sun
Full Sun to Partial Shade
Water Preferences: Mesic
Minimum cold hardiness: Zone 9a -6.7 °C (20 °F) to -3.9 °C (25 °F)
Maximum recommended zone: Zone 11
Plant Height: 6 - 8 inches
Plant Spread: 22 - 25 inches
Flowers: Showy
Flower Color: White
Bloom Size: 1"-2"
Flower Time: Late spring or early summer
Summer
Late summer or early fall
Containers: Suitable in 1 gallon
Suitable in 3 gallon or larger
Suitable for hanging baskets

    This flowering annual thrives in my zone 7b North Georgia Mountains garden. This variety spreads throughout the summer, and continues to bloom with no deadheading needed. Blooming is enhanced with bi-weekly liquid Bloom Booster fertilizer.
